Spring this year is especially exciting at Allen Edmonds. We have a talented line-up of new shoes just now hitting the stores. Here are a few highlights:
As mentioned in my last blog, it’s the PARK AVENUE’S 30th Anniversary as The Great American Business Shoe. The new walnut pebble grain P.A. responds to the current movement to “Authentic Americana” (as Newsweek called the new fashion trend). Now the P.A. not only looks great in black calfskin with a dark suit, it also looks fantastic with jeans or khakis in walnut grain.
The early results in our retail stores tell us that we’ve once again connected with our loyal customers with the re-introduction of two additional Timeless Classics – the BENTON and the WALTON. The WALTON, with its double oak sole retro-profile, seems especially exciting to new and younger customers given the fashion momentum toward authentic and classic Americana. In the same vein, the MACNEIL long wingtip has become more versatile in its new navy, walnut and burgundy leathers. The LOMBARD is a blucher wingtip on the tasteful Executive Collection rubber sole.
The younger man’s “look” in business casual settings or at social gatherings today is an untucked white shirt with a patterned inside collar and cuffs, a pair of dark blue jeans and a pair of brown or walnut WALTONs, MACNEIL s, LOMBARDs or STRANDs. To see why, try our new pants comparison feature on our wwwallenedmonds.com website with the STRAND.
The CHARLESTON, AUGUSTA, BOSTON and WESTCHESTER offer fresh new takes on some classic leather-bottom silhouettes – a mocc toe, a medallioned balmoral, a monk strap and a classic penny loafer.
To our collection of Italian-made shoes, we’ve added a couple new winners. The FIRENZE is a comfort-first, rubber-soled slip-on with a bit more fashion-forward toe shape and the RIMINI is a penny with that sleek, thin Italian leather sole and superb ultra-soft leather. Both are perfect under khakis or other lightweight pants in spring and summer, with socks or without.
Finally, take a look at a couple new Weekend Collection shoes. The WINTHROP is an incredibly supple but durable driving moccasin that we’ll put up against any in the field in terms of leather quality and construction. And the BOULDER Venetian slip-on promises to be the power-hitter of this roster. It has a thicker drop-in sole with ergonomic cushioning built into the sole’s interesting pattern. The BOULDER’s mudguard rim with the sole’s side extensions, plus the water repellant leather treatment we’ve added, make this the perfect transition shoe – it’s great in spring but also fully capable to handle winter’s last roar.
